在Node.js中创建视频URL Blob的方法如下:
fs
和path
模块,用于读取和处理文件。fs
模块的readFileSync
方法读取视频文件。例如,假设视频文件名为video.mp4
,可以使用以下代码读取文件:const fs = require('fs');
const path = require('path');
const videoPath = path.join(__dirname, 'video.mp4');
const videoData = fs.readFileSync(videoPath);
Buffer
对象将视频数据转换为Blob对象。然后,使用URL.createObjectURL
方法创建视频的URL。const videoBlob = new Blob([videoData], { type: 'video/mp4' });
const videoURL = URL.createObjectURL(videoBlob);
console.log(videoURL); // 输出视频URL
这样,你就可以在Node.js中创建视频URL Blob了。
请注意,以上代码示例中使用的是Node.js的核心模块和API,没有提及任何特定的云计算品牌商。如果你需要在腾讯云中存储和处理视频文件,可以使用腾讯云的对象存储服务(COS)和云点播服务(VOD)。具体的腾讯云产品和产品介绍链接地址,请参考腾讯云官方文档。
领取专属 10元无门槛券
手把手带您无忧上云